C++的变长模板参数和模板元编程,在我看来,它们不仅仅是语言特性,更像是一对默契的搭档,共同为C++开发者打开了一扇通往更高维度泛型编程的大门。
自定义错误类型与上下文增强 Go 的 error 是接口,我们可以封装带有状态码、描述和元数据的自定义错误。
以下是常见的错误处理方式。
这意味着我们需要一种机制,通过一个标识符(如用户ID)来检索特定的用户数据,并在页面上进行渲染。
示例代码: #include <map> #include <iostream> std::map<std::string, int> myMap = {{"apple", 1}, {"banana", 2}, {"cherry", 3}}; for (auto it = myMap.begin(); it != myMap.end(); ++it) { std::cout << "键: " << it->first << ", 值: " << it->second << std::endl; } 注意:it->first 表示键,it->second 表示值。
s.str.replace(r'^([^:]+)', r'\1_sub', regex=True): 使用 str.replace() 方法进行字符串替换。
直接使用 .extract() 或 .get() 在一个选择器对象上(例如 response.css('p')[0].get())通常会返回完整的 html 字符串。
它将SQL逻辑与数据分离,确保用户输入不会被当作SQL命令执行。
阅读者需要对Go的内存模型和CGo机制有深入的理解才能正确解读代码意图。
交易执行(Execution):记录了交易的实际执行情况,包括成交价格、成交数量、成交时间等。
然而,如果处理循环逻辑不当,可能会导致只处理第一个url或产生其他意想不到的行为。
• 使用HTTPS:通过Let's Encrypt免费获取SSL证书,提升数据传输安全性。
PHP处理JSON数据的核心是json_encode()和json_decode()函数,分别用于将PHP数组或对象转换为JSON字符串、将JSON字符串解析为PHP数据。
41 查看详情 class Complex { double real, imag; public: Complex(double r = 0, double i = 0) : real(r), imag(i) {} <pre class='brush:php;toolbar:false;'>friend std::ostream& operator<<(std::ostream& out, const Complex& c);}; std::ostream& operator<<(std::ostream& out, const Complex& c) { out << c.real << " + " << c.imag << "i"; return out; }3. 常见可重载运算符示例 以下是一些常用运算符的重载方式: 赋值运算符 = 需要手动实现深拷贝,防止资源重复释放。
这是与其他语言不同的关键点,确保循环正常推进。
通过在代码中推广使用此类函数,可以显著提高应用程序的稳定性和数据处理的准确性。
遵循本教程中的最佳实践,将有助于您编写更健壮、更安全的数据库交互代码。
因此,直接使用 Go 的 crypto/des 等包通常无法获得与 crypt.crypt 相同的结果,因为 crypt.crypt 不仅仅是 DES 加密,而是一套特定的 Unix 密码哈希流程。
不复杂但容易忽略空指针判断。
method='highs' 指定使用 'highs' 求解器,它通常更高效。
本文链接:http://www.ensosoft.com/112511_4089c1.html